In my masterlink system there are two link speaker BL2000, which are working very well regarding Radio, CD, N.Music and N.Radio.

Recently I have upgraded the BS9000 with a ChromecastAudio connected to AUX-input, where  command A.AUX is used for operation. It works fine on all units (BS9000, BS3000, BV6-26, BL3500), but without the BL2000's. They don't react at all on the command A.AUX. It seems they don't recognize that type of command - they are still in off position.

Do anyone out there know if this is a SW issue, or it doesn't matter which version of software is used. Simply, the BL2000 is not compatible with A.AUX.....?

Hi Carl!

They don't under stand that command, be course they missing the newer software update. (you need v1.6?)

I have the same problem. I have solved this with this solution: Start your system with A.aux in another room first, then push the power button on your Beolab 2000 unit, works great for me, but its not perfect.

Then you can turn of the system in the first room, and still enjoy your Beolab 2000. 

 

Hope it works for You
